Story

Former President Donald Trump met with the family of Rachel Morin, a Maryland mother of five who was tragically murdered in August 2023. The alleged perpetrator, Victor Antonio Martinez-Hernandez, a 23-year-old illegal immigrant from El Salvador, has been arrested in connection with the crime. During the meeting, Morin's mother, Patty, expressed her grief and frustration, highlighting the dangers posed by criminals and the impact of open borders on communities far from the southern border. Patty Morin recounted the safe environment of the Ma & Pa Trail in Bel-Air, Maryland, where her daughter was killed. She emphasized the normalcy of the area, where families often walk with children. At the time of Rachel's death, Patty was in Kentucky mourning the loss of her grandchild when she received the devastating news from a Maryland detective. She lamented the loss of her daughter and pointed to a pattern of violence linked to illegal immigrants in their county. Sheriff Jeffery Gahler confirmed the arrest of Martinez-Hernandez, noting that DNA evidence connected him to a previous home invasion in Los Angeles, where he allegedly attacked a mother and her 9-year-old daughter. Gahler underscored the alarming implications of such crimes occurring far from the border, raising concerns about safety and security in communities across the nation. The Morin family’s tragedy has sparked discussions about immigration policies and public safety.
